Albéniz: Malagueña, Opus 165, No. 3 for the Piano

Isaac Albéniz , one of Spain’s finest pianists, was a prolific composer for the piano. He used the guitar as his instrumental model and drew inspiration from the traits of Andalusian folk music without actually using folk themes. This piece is from a set entitled España (Spain) that was composed in 1890. The title Malagueña comes from the Mediterranean seaport city of Malaga.
